I am seeing a persistent crash on Mac Lion with 3.3.2503.

The situation is with the Dashboard PlugIn, Preferences dialog. When the layout of the Dashboard is changed, (add or remove an instrument) the system will crash on leaving the preferences dialog by the "OK" button. But strangely, it only crashes if the Dashboard is floating, not docked. If docked, all is well, no crash.

I stepped back to Betas from earlier last year, say 3.3.16xx, and still have the trouble there. So this issue seems to have been around a long time.

Sean...

re:
Code:
I noticed that enabling chart outlines on cm93 mode is very slow. Can anyone else notice this?

   I commented out the two lines that delete the display list and set it  to zero, and the performance was once again very good.  Is there some  reason for why this can't be?
The issue is panning at small scale. We need to make sure we pick up the new cell MCOVR structures. Dropping the list is is a crude solution, but safe.

See FS#1601 : Charts CM93 missing chart outlines - a "Vestas" check.

This issue needs more thought: how to be sure and show just the right larger scale outlines, without excessive clutter and performance hit.

Looks good on Ubuntu 14.10 amd64 opengl self-compiled against wx3.0. I _think_ the fonts are a big bigger (or bolder) than before, which is nice.

However, I noticed one thing (which I think is not really new): the object-query for a light does not show the light properties if you have a mark / waypoint at the same place. See attached screenshots (close to the "San Mateo area" from my previous bug reports; though I think this does not matter). I simply right-clicked on the buoy and selected "drop mark" and object-query lost it's light description.

I know that the light description only shows up if light display is enabled, which I also think is not nice (reported a long time ago and back then it was deemed "too much hassle" to fix).

Same also happens if there is a layer waypoint at the mark (of which I have many because my club uses lots of these marks as racing marks).

Another problem with pop-ups: when there is a layer waypoint at a buoy and you double-click on the buoy, it shows the layer waypoint properties (instead of the buoy properties) even if the layer is disabled. Right-click and "object query" correctly shows the buoy properties.

"I wouldn't call this a bug, but the quilting S/W sort of hiccups while panning down the NY state barge canal.

I'm at chart 14786_59, zoomed to scale= 15800, the next chart (_60) appears in the chart bar but isn't quilted. (EC1)

If you left click the chart bar (2nd chart from the left) to see its contents, chart _60 will be displayed quilted with _59 properly.

If you don't click the chart bar, and drag it a little further west, it will display a strange quilt. (EC2)

Drag it a little bit further and it will _59 disappears and _60 is dispalyed.


This behavior is caused by having "Full Screen Quilting" turned off.
